A bootloop on the Allview A5 Easy occurs when the device repeatedly restarts without fully loading Android. This is commonly caused by a failed software update, corrupted system files, or an incompatible app. Most bootloops can be resolved without losing data by clearing the cache partition first before attempting a factory reset.

Factory reset may be needed as a last resort — erases all data.

1

On your Allview A5 Easy: force restart: hold Power for 15–30 seconds

2

If still looping: enter Recovery Mode

3

Navigate to 'Wipe cache partition' → confirm → reboot

4

If still looping: return to Recovery

5

Select 'Wipe data/factory reset' → confirm (erases all data)

6

Last resort: use your manufacturer's PC tool to reinstall firmware
